Abstract
A method of manufacturing an electronic device including a step of giving a droplet of a liquid containing a formation material of a member that constitutes the electronic device to a plurality of portions on a substrate while said substrate and a droplet ejecting portion are moved relatively in an in-surface direction of said substrate , wherein the droplet is given while a position on a droplet given surface to which the droplet is given is corrected in accordance with the distribution of distances between the ejecting portion and the droplet given surface on the substrate which occurs when the substrate and the ejecting portion are relatively moved. Thereby forming the member constituting the electronic device accurately at the plural portion on the substrate , and thus forming plural electronic device of same charactoristics.
